[Bug 707537] [NEW] Graphic slow after laptop display turned off

 

Public bug reported:

Binary package hint: xorg

When I leave the laptop and turn back when screen got black (blanked by
laptop bios and not by screensaver) moving the mouse or pressing a key
to wake it up, I can see graphics is very slow (switching between
windows, changing desktop etc).

Steps to reproduce:
1. Disable screensaver
2. Wait until screen becomes dark
3. Move the mouse or press a key

Graphic performance is slow and Xorg consumes a notable amount of
processor time.
